The word 凌汛 is formed by combining 凌, which refers to ice or ice floes, with 汛, which denotes a flood or high-water event; together, they create a compound term that specifically describes an ice-jam flood, where obstructing ice causes river water to rise and overflow.

Word Definition - 凌汛

líng xùn ice-jam flood (arising when river downstream freezes more than upstream)
